    corrupted registry, endless boot loop, no recovery console

    have a server with windows xp and windows server 2003 installed

    it appears the registry has been corrupted, the recovery console was not
    installed, and the only backup was on a tape drive installed in the server

    the server is now caught in an endless boot loop and if the automatic
    shutdown is turned off, the error message says:
    STOP: c000021a {Fatal System Error} The Non-DLL file included in known DLL
    list. system process terminated unexpectedly with a status of 0xc000036f
    (0xe164dca8 0x00000000). The system has been shut down.

    so it looks like a non driver (DLL) file is in a known driver (DLL) list in
    the registry, corrupting it

    how can this be fixed?

    Painful though this might be, you should be able to boot from your original
    CD, rerun Setup, and have it repair the Windows installation in question.
    This will of course set you back to the version that you have on CD, so
    making sure that this system is not Internet-visible is advisable, and you
    will need to reinstall whatever patches or service packs have become
    available for said OS.

    Hi Effi,

    Please boot from the W2k3 CD and boot into Recovery Console.

    Try:

    chkdsk c: /f

    (Assuming that C: is your system drive).

    I'm not sure if SFC command works in recovery console, but you can try
    doing:

    sfc /scannow

    (to scan for DLL files and make sure that they are in working/valid).

    If SFC doesn't work, your last resort would be doing a reinstallation of
    Windows 2003 (from the W2k3 CD).
